Hum, Croatia

The 6 smallest cities in the world

2. 23 people live there

The frescoes of the XII century are perfectly preserved in Hum. In addition, there are 13 houses, 2 streets, 2 temples, a museum, a shop, a post office, a cemetery, a restaurant, a hotel. In mid-June, every year the city holds mayoral elections, in which only men participate. The procedure ends with a dance festival.

Why we're going: For a drink. The restaurant serves homemade 38-degree tincture on medicinal herbs Humska Viska, which is prepared according to the recipe of the ancient Celts. Locals claim that this recipe is more than 2 thousand years old.
